Unique NYC

The California design show comes east just in time to support local artists post-Sandy

Originally established in LA four years ago, State of Unique has grown to become the country’s largest independently curated design mart. The two-day events are so loved that founder Sonja Rasula recently expanded her Made-in-America marketplace initiative to San Francisco and now New York. The Bike Porter

Copenhagen Part's innovative twist on the classic bicycle basket

As part of a research project for the New York City Department of Parks and Recreation, the New York-based design studio NR 2154 and the Danish company Goodmorning Technology came together to create an integrated bike scheme for the city. Anna Karlin

The NYC art director adds furniture and fine objects to her artful repertoire

As an art director, Anna Karlin has built a career around designing graphics, exhibitions and installations for clients such as Todd Snyder, Thompson Hotels, Swarovski Crystal and U2.
